 body {font-family: "Jost"; color: #6B7280; line-height: 1.7} h1 {font-weight: 600; font-size: 40px; color: #1A1F2E; line-height: 1.2} h2 {color: #1A1F2E; font-size: 30px; font-weight: 600; line-height: 1.3} h3 {font-size: 24px; line-height: 1.35} body.bricks-is-frontend :focus-visible {outline: none} @supports not selector(:focus-visible) { body.bricks-is-frontend :focus {outline: none; }} .brxe-container {width: 1440px} .woocommerce main.site-main {width: 1440px} #brx-content.wordpress {width: 1440px} .brxe-section {padding-right: 16px; padding-left: 16px}:where(:root) .bricks-color-primary {color: #000}:where(:root) .bricks-background-primary {background-color: #000}@media (max-width: 767px) { h1 {font-size: 30px} h2 {font-size: 24px} h3 {font-size: 20px}}